× In my family we usually don't celebrate birthdays but occasionally me and my friends go out sometimes and they bring some cake for me and we celebrate together.
✓ In my family we usually don't celebrate birthdays but occasionally my friends and I go out sometimes and they bring some cake for me and we celebrate together.
The pronoun 'me' is incorrectly used as the subject of the sentence. The correct subject pronoun is 'I'. Therefore, 'me and my friends' should be 'my friends and I'. This is a common pronoun case error.
× Once my family organized this big party for me and invited my friends over at our house and they decorated my room and the hall they had the party at.
✓ Once my family organized this big party for me and invited my friends over to our house and they decorated my room and the hall where they had the party.

× Celebrating your birthday isn't as important but I believe it's a great way to make someone day and make them happy since it is a memorable and fun day because everyone enjoyed themselves.
✓ Celebrating your birthday isn't very important but I believe it's a great way to make someone's day and make them happy since it is a memorable and fun day because everyone enjoys themselves.
The phrase 'make someone day' is missing the possessive apostrophe 's' to form 'someone's day'. Also, 'everyone enjoyed themselves' is inconsistent in tense with the rest of the sentence; 'enjoys' is the correct present tense form to match the context.
× I don't specifically know that, but I believe China is. They value birthdays a lot.
✓ I don't specifically know, but I believe that in China, people value birthdays a lot.
The sentence 'I believe China is' is incomplete and unclear. It lacks an object or complement. The correction clarifies the meaning by specifying 'in China, people value birthdays a lot.' This improves sentence structure and clarity.
